On such a beautiful vlog i want to share the AARTI (We can say it as the good words/thoughts/orison ) of lord Ganesha with its English pronunciation and translation , this was written by Saint Samartha Ramdas Swami in 16th century .
marathi words-सुखकर्ता दुःखहर्ता ll वार्ता विघ्नाची ll
Pronunciation in english-Sukhakarta Dukhaharta , vaarta vighnachi
Translation in English-
lord , you are maker of happieness , destroyer of negativity
marathi words-नुरवी पुरवी प्रेम ll कृपा जयाची ll
Pronunciation in english-
nuravi puravi prem, krupa jayachi
Translation in English-
who give us love , bless us
marathi words-सर्वांगी सुंदर ll उटी शेंदुराची ll
Pronunciation in english-
sarvangi sundar , uti shendurachi
Translation in English-
you have a beautuful layer of sindur
marathi words-कंठी झळके माळ ll मुक्ताफळाची ll
Pronunciation in english-
kanthi zalake maal , muktafalachi
Translation in English-
you have a shiny neckless of pearl
marathi words-जयदेव जयदेव जय मंगलमूर्ती ll दर्शनमात्रे मनःकामनापूर्ती ll
Pronunciation in english-
jaydev jaydev , jay mangalmurti
darshanmatre mankamanapurti
Translation in English-
Hail you the idol of happiness,as and when we see you, fulfil our desires
marathi words-रत्नखचित फरा ll तुज गौरीकुमरा ll
Pronunciation in english-
ratnakhachit fara , tuj gaurikumara
Translation in English-
son of goddess gauri have feather of diamond
marathi words-चंदनाची उटी ll कुंकुम केशरा ll
Pronunciation in english-
chandanachi uti , kumkum keshara
Translation in English-
layer of sandalwood and red kunkum situated on your forehead
marathi words-हिरेजडित मुकुट शोभतो बरा ll
Pronunciation in english-
hirejadit mukut, shobhato bara
Translation in English-
crown with diamond suites you very nicely
marathi words-रुणझुणती नूपुरे चरणी घागरिया ll
Pronunciation in english-
runajhunati nupure , charani ghagariya
Translation in English-
anklets in your feet make sweet noise
marathi words-लंबोदर पीतांबर फणीवर बंधना ll
Pronunciation in english-
lambodar pitambar , fanivar bandhana
Translation in English-
You have big stomach , coiled by snake
marathi words-सरळ सोंड वक्रतुंड त्रिनयना ll
Pronunciation in english-
saral sond vakratund trinayana
Translation in English-
you have straight trunk , slightly curved face with 3 eyes
marathi words-दास रामाचा वाट पाहे सदना ll
Pronunciation in english-
das ramacha , vat pahe sadana
Translation in English-
deciple of lord shreeram ( samarth ramdas swami ) eageely waiting for you at his home
marathi words-संकटी पावावे , निर्वाणी रक्षावे ll सुरवर वंदना
Pronunciation in english-
sankati pavave nirvani rakshave , suravar vandana
Translation in English-
we beg you to , bless us during our bad time , save my devine soul after my death,,
